WebAncient debris generates in the Nether in the form of veins of one to four blocks (veins in adjacent chunks can occasionally increase this amount). The average amount of ore blocks per chunk is 1.65, and the typical maximum is 5 blocks, although it is technically possible to find a whopping 11 blocks. WebNether quartz ore can generate in the Nether in the form of blobs. Nether quartz ore attempts to replace netherrack 16 times per chunk in blobs of size 0-24, from levels 10 to 117, in all Nether biomes except basalt deltas. In basalt deltas, Nether quartz ore attempts to generate 32 times per chunk as there are fewer valid generation areas. northern pipe products fargo
